2021-05-11 13:19:12

by Nikolay Borisov

[permalink] [raw]
Subject: [PATCH] MAINTAINERS: Add lib/percpu* as part of percpu entry

Without this patch get_maintainers.pl on a patch which modified
lib/percpu_refcount.c produces:

Jens Axboe <[email protected]> (commit_signer:2/5=40%)
Ming Lei <[email protected]> (commit_signer:2/5=40%,authored:2/5=40%,added_lines:99/114=87%,removed_lines:34/43=79%)
"Paul E. McKenney" <[email protected]> (commit_signer:1/5=20%,authored:1/5=20%,added_lines:9/114=8%,removed_lines:3/43=7%)
Tejun Heo <[email protected]> (commit_signer:1/5=20%)
Andrew Morton <[email protected]> (commit_signer:1/5=20%)
Nikolay Borisov <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
Joe Perches <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
[email protected] (open list)

Whereas with the patch applied it now (properly) prints:

Dennis Zhou <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
Tejun Heo <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
Christoph Lameter <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
[email protected] (open list)

Signed-off-by: Nikolay Borisov <[email protected]>
---
MAINTAINERS | 1 +
1 file changed, 1 insertion(+)

diff --git a/MAINTAINERS b/MAINTAINERS
index d92f85ca831d..b18fed606ddd 100644
--- a/MAINTAINERS
+++ b/MAINTAINERS
@@ -14004,6 +14004,7 @@ S: Maintained
T: git git://git.kernel.org/pub/scm/linux/kernel/git/dennis/percpu.git
F: arch/*/include/asm/percpu.h
F: include/linux/percpu*.h
+F: lib/percpu*.c
F: mm/percpu*.c

PER-TASK DELAY ACCOUNTING
--
2.25.1


2021-05-11 13:52:34

by Dennis Zhou

[permalink] [raw]
Subject: Re: [PATCH] MAINTAINERS: Add lib/percpu* as part of percpu entry

Hello,

On Tue, May 11, 2021 at 04:17:37PM +0300, Nikolay Borisov wrote:
> Without this patch get_maintainers.pl on a patch which modified
> lib/percpu_refcount.c produces:
>
> Jens Axboe <[email protected]> (commit_signer:2/5=40%)
> Ming Lei <[email protected]> (commit_signer:2/5=40%,authored:2/5=40%,added_lines:99/114=87%,removed_lines:34/43=79%)
> "Paul E. McKenney" <[email protected]> (commit_signer:1/5=20%,authored:1/5=20%,added_lines:9/114=8%,removed_lines:3/43=7%)
> Tejun Heo <[email protected]> (commit_signer:1/5=20%)
> Andrew Morton <[email protected]> (commit_signer:1/5=20%)
> Nikolay Borisov <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
> Joe Perches <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
> [email protected] (open list)
>
> Whereas with the patch applied it now (properly) prints:
>
> Dennis Zhou <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> Tejun Heo <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> Christoph Lameter <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> [email protected] (open list)
>
> Signed-off-by: Nikolay Borisov <[email protected]>
> ---
> MAINTAINERS |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/MAINTAINERS b/MAINTAINERS
> index d92f85ca831d..b18fed606ddd 100644
> --- a/MAINTAINERS
> +++ b/MAINTAINERS
> @@ -14004,6 +14004,7 @@ S: Maintained
> T: git git://git.kernel.org/pub/scm/linux/kernel/git/dennis/percpu.git
> F: arch/*/include/asm/percpu.h
> F: include/linux/percpu*.h
> +F: lib/percpu*.c
> F: mm/percpu*.c
>
> PER-TASK DELAY ACCOUNTING
> --
> 2.25.1
>

Yeah, in the past I've taken percpu_ref stuff, so I think this makes
sense. If no one has any objections I'll pick this up and your other
patch.

Thanks,
Dennis

2021-05-13 04:50:05

by Dennis Zhou

[permalink] [raw]
Subject: Re: [PATCH] MAINTAINERS: Add lib/percpu* as part of percpu entry

On Tue, May 11, 2021 at 01:48:36PM +0000, Dennis Zhou wrote:
> Hello,
>
> On Tue, May 11, 2021 at 04:17:37PM +0300, Nikolay Borisov wrote:
> > Without this patch get_maintainers.pl on a patch which modified
> > lib/percpu_refcount.c produces:
> >
> > Jens Axboe <[email protected]> (commit_signer:2/5=40%)
> > Ming Lei <[email protected]> (commit_signer:2/5=40%,authored:2/5=40%,added_lines:99/114=87%,removed_lines:34/43=79%)
> > "Paul E. McKenney" <[email protected]> (commit_signer:1/5=20%,authored:1/5=20%,added_lines:9/114=8%,removed_lines:3/43=7%)
> > Tejun Heo <[email protected]> (commit_signer:1/5=20%)
> > Andrew Morton <[email protected]> (commit_signer:1/5=20%)
> > Nikolay Borisov <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
> > Joe Perches <[email protected]> (authored:1/5=20%,removed_lines:3/43=7%)
> > [email protected] (open list)
> >
> > Whereas with the patch applied it now (properly) prints:
> >
> > Dennis Zhou <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> > Tejun Heo <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> > Christoph Lameter <[email protected]> (maintainer:PER-CPU MEMORY ALLOCATOR)
> > [email protected] (open list)
> >
> > Signed-off-by: Nikolay Borisov <[email protected]>
> > ---
> > MAINTAINERS | 1 +
> > 1 file changed, 1 insertion(+)
> >
> > diff --git a/MAINTAINERS b/MAINTAINERS
> > index d92f85ca831d..b18fed606ddd 100644
> > --- a/MAINTAINERS
> > +++ b/MAINTAINERS
> > @@ -14004,6 +14004,7 @@ S: Maintained
> > T: git git://git.kernel.org/pub/scm/linux/kernel/git/dennis/percpu.git
> > F: arch/*/include/asm/percpu.h
> > F: include/linux/percpu*.h
> > +F: lib/percpu*.c
> > F: mm/percpu*.c
> >
> > PER-TASK DELAY ACCOUNTING
> > --
> > 2.25.1
> >
>
> Yeah, in the past I've taken percpu_ref stuff, so I think this makes
> sense. If no one has any objections I'll pick this up and your other
> patch.
>
> Thanks,
> Dennis

I've applied this to for-5.13-fixes. I've also updated the mailing list
to linux-mm.

Thanks,
Dennis